I can’t tell you how disgusted I am by today’s headlines and the waste of space (June 6). We get headlines and a full page with the life stories of two people who have a beef against Graham Platner. He’s got a boatload of baggage, we know this. He’s exercised some questionable judgment in his past. Maybe one could doubt that he’s always lived up to his expressed values.
But Sen. Susan Collins has repeatedly shown us that her judgment and values stink. Her vote to confirm Justice Brett Kavanaugh — a man credibly accused of far worse than Platner’s been accused of — resulted in the end of Roe v. Wade and American women’s right to control their bodies and fates. Collins also voted to confirm Kristi Noem and refused to call for Noem’s ouster when Noem’s ICE agents fatally shot protesters.
Why don’t we get articles about Collins’ values and judgment? No, we get pages of utter trivia. The beef a former Heritage Foundation employee has with the New York Times; the “news” a former Platner campaign person was in foster care as a child. Who the freak cares?
**Sigrid Olson**
_Cape Elizabeth_
